An AGI allows landlords to increase rent beyond the annual guideline (2.1% in 2026, down from 2.5% in 2024 and 2025) for extraordinary costs: major capital repairs, significant increases in property taxes, or utility cost increases. Requires LTB approval through an L5 application.
Yes, tenants can attend the AGI hearing and challenge: whether the work qualifies as capital expenditure vs. maintenance, the reasonableness of costs, whether work was necessary, allocation of costs among units, and useful life calculations.
AGIs are capped at 3% above the guideline per year for capital expenditures and utilities. There's no cap for municipal tax increases. The total AGI can be phased in over up to 3 years if it exceeds the annual cap.
